The Man That Changed My Life





The Man That Changed My Life



People come and people go
In and out of  every life
Friends and lovers
Acquaintances
Sometimes a husband 
Or a wife.

If we are lucky, someone appears
Like no one else has ever been
And makes us forget all of the others
Be they lover, mate or friend.

And when they come into our lives
They fill a void that's always there
From our day of birth until our death
That can't be filled by another's care.

I do not pretend to understand that
I guess God decided and made it thus
So all our lives we look for something
To fill that hole inside of us.

And I, like you, have searched forever
For things or people to set us free
And never found the thing we needed
Till we found it in you and me.

And oh, the things that you taught me!
Found talents hidden in my soul
You dug them out and polished them
And made them shine just like pure gold!

And I found in you what had been lost
Things so precious and so rare
Things no one else knew existed
But things that flourished in my care.

You changed my life and I hope
That I changed yours in some small way
You're now a part of my little heart
And there in my night and in my day.

So funny, funny are you to me
You make me smile and laugh out loud
You bring me joy when I least expect it
You are my sun in every cloud.

My other self I didn't know
Until I saw me in your eyes
And you saw you inside of mine
Much to your hard fought surprise.

You take the place of a thousand people
Who enter and leave quietly
Within the confines of my life
But none mean what you mean to me.

Wherever you end up, my love
Wherever on this earth you go
Remember I am always there 
Remember too, I need you so.

And in my heart, I recognize
Even if you can't yourself
That I've changed you by excavating
The treasures in your hidden depths.

Things that make you who you are
But more the man that you can be
A lover, a warrior, a man of God
When I look at you, that's what I see.





©By Voo Shining Stone

A Man Again


My life is like a shadowed room
With sun afraid to shine
But I would throw the windows open
If only, you were mine.

Cobwebs full of memories
Hang ’round this silent place
And everywhere my eyes might look
It’s there I see your face.

There is no music in this house
Except within my head
It followed you right out the door
Glanced back, and then fell dead.

I look around and see myself
A remnant of a man
A ghost that has no one to haunt
A soul without a hand.

For I would reach that hand to you
And let you taste my tears
And I would show myself to you
And let you see my fears.

If only you would come to me
If only you would come
And turn this ravaged heart of mine
Into your home sweet home.

It rains here every single night
It thunders out my pain
I cannot look upon the light
Till I see you again.

My bed lies un-used and un-made
For I no longer sleep
My dreams are fragile waking things
Not real enough to keep.

But midnights in the lightning’s flash
The mirror shows you true
Standing here alone with me
In love like I’m with you.

I do not move for if I do
Your sweet face fades away
And all my love and all my need
Cannot make you stay.

So I stand still and do not breathe
And do not speak out loud
But love you with my hungry eyes
No longer, cold and proud.

For when I was a mortal man
And not this apparition
I took for granted all I had
So full of supposition.

Then I woke up, a broken man
In this broken home
My sad voice echoing off the walls
Begging you to come.

Love, come, love, come!
Live here with me again
Bring back the days I counted loss
Not knowing what I’d gained.

The past is never truly gone
I know that for a fact
But show me where you threw my love
And I’ll go get it back.

My life is like a shadowed room
And your smile is the sun
If you’ll just meet me halfway, love
The rest of the way, I’ll run.

I’d tear these dusty cobwebs down
If you gave me a sign
I know I could be a real man again
If  you were only, mine.






©by Voo
